Try a Pore Refining Mask in Your Blemish-Prone Skincare Routine

Are you prone to blemishes? Do you have an oily skin type? Then, it’s essential to keep your pores clear and your skin hydrated. The good news is, a simple skincare routine can be satisfying. You may enjoy clearing and hydrating products made for oily or blemish-prone skin. You might even try using a pore refining mask once or twice a week. Some easy skincare tips can make a big difference. Here’s why.

1. Cleanse Without Stripping Your Skin

If you have oily or blemish-prone skin, consider choosing a cleanser made for your skin type. The right cleanser can help your complexion look clear and feel hydrated. That way, your skin won’t feel stripped or irritated. Avoid ingredients like benzoyl peroxide that’s often included in blemish-clearing products. Instead, look for a cleanser made with detoxifying and clarifying organic key ingredients. Organic lemon and cherry juices clarify, while organic aloe and algae help hydrate the skin.

2. Use a Pore Refining Mask 1-2 Times Per Week

A well-formulated pore refining mask can draw out impurities that tend to clog your pores. That way, your skin can appear smooth and clear. After cleansing, apply a generous layer of the pore refining mask to your face for detoxing. Beneficial ingredients include activated bamboo charcoal and bentonite and kaolin clays. These ingredients help absorb and draw out excess oils and impurities. A blend of plant-derived polyhydroxy acids can even help your complexion feel softer and smoother. Your best bet is to search for a pore refining mask that works for all skin types. Use your mask once or twice per week by following the directions on the product. This will allow you to see how your skin develops depending on your routine.

3. Follow with a Serum Designed to Help Reduce Breakouts

To address your concerns, consider using a serum formulated for your skin type. A serum with concentrated ingredients can help nourish, hydrate, and protect your skin. Plus, the best serums won’t leave your skin feeling greasy. Oily and blemish-prone skin types might enjoy a serum made with salicylic acid. This beta hydroxy acid goes deep into the pores to keep them clear and help reduce the chance of breakouts. Other ingredients like vitamin C and organic botanical acids can also support your skin tone and texture.

4. Apply Natural Moisturizer with Key Organic Ingredients

Round out your routine by applying a lightweight moisturizer. Choose one made with rich antioxidants and vitamins. You might use an oil free moisturizer with key organic moisturizer ingredients to give your skin the hydration it needs. Search for an oil free natural moisturizer for oily, combination, and blemish-prone skin. A product made with powerful ingredients like plant-derived glycerin, sodium hyaluronate, and organic botanicals like pomegranate and aloe is a great choice. For the daytime, make sure your oil free moisturizer offers zinc SPF 30 to help keep your skin protected.
